ZIP code 10553 in Mount Vernon, New York has a population of 10,170. The median household income is $84,478, which is 11% above the national average. Median home value is $551,200, 98% above the US average. 41.9% of residents hold a bachelor's degree or higher.

ZIP code 10553 is classified by USPS as a standard delivery area and covers roughly 1.8 square miles in Mount Vernon, Westchester County, New York. The area is home to 10,170 residents, producing a population density of 5,671 people per square mile, and falls within the New York time zone. These USPS and Census boundary values drive every downstream statistic on this page, including the benchmarks that compare 10553 against New York and the nation.

On the economic side, the median household income for ZIP 10553 sits at $84,478 (9% below the New York average), while per-capita income is $39,479. The poverty rate stands at 11.9% and the unemployment rate at 6.7%. On housing, the median home value is $551,200 (46% above the state average) with median rent at $1,773 per month, and 46.3% of occupied units are owner-occupied, a direct signal of whether 10553 behaves more like a homeowner neighborhood or a renter-heavy ZIP.

Education and household profile round out the picture: 41.9%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 36.5, and the average commute is 37 minutes. Home values in ZIP 10553 have increased 18.3% over the past year (2024). Since 2000, this ZIP has seen +188% cumulative appreciation.

Census Bureau data shows 175 business establishments in ZIP 10553, employing approximately 1,795 people with a combined annual payroll of $93,239,000.
